Abstract
Bearing a lone pair of electrons on nitrogen and a highly polarized N O double bond, nitroso compounds can act both as nucleophiles and electrophiles. Such dually reactive nature allows nitroso compounds to participate in many chemical transformations, 1 such as ene reactions, 2 nitroso aldol reactions, 3 coupling reactions with alkynes 4 and amines 5 and Grignard reactions. 6 Moreover, nitroso compounds have been exploited in various cycloaddition ...
